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 10,300 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2008 CADILLAC CTS in 2008 was $35,989.
The average price for used 2008 CADILLAC CTS nowadays in 2024 is $7,950 which is 22%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 8,344 miles.

Economic downturns can lead to decreased demand and lower resale values for vehicles, as buyers may defer purchasing vehicles or opt for less expensive alternatives.
Technology plays a significant role in the depreciation of vehicles, as models with outdated tech depreciate faster due to lower consumer demand for older features.
A 'clean title' generally indicates that the vehicle has not been significantly damaged in the past and has no history of major incidents such as salvage or theft, if such information is documented.
